Creating a Supportive Dwelling Natural environment


A effectively‑adapted household decreases confusion and anxiety in your cherished a person although easing caregiver responsibilities.


Security To start with



  • Install get bars, non-slip mats, and distinct pathways

  • Use door alarms, good locks, and night lights

  • Label cupboards with phrases or photographs for intuitive use

  • Established digital reminders for foods, medications, and appointments


Comfort and ease & Familiarity



  • Display favored shots and familiar objects

  • Hold routines consistent—meals, rest, and work out at similar instances

  • Generate cozy exercise corners with puzzles, new music, or crafts

  • Preserve nice ambient Seems, for instance mother nature Appears or delicate new music



Conversation Approaches That Enable


Communication shifts as dementia progresses. Adapting how we discuss, hear, and join helps make a spectacular change.


Verbal Changes



  • Speak in short sentences utilizing very clear language

  • Target just one plan at any given time and discuss gradually

  • Use the person’s identify and a relaxed, welcoming tone


Non‑Verbal Cues



  • Retain eye Get hold of and smile warmly

  • Gestures, demonstration, and facial expressions aid being familiar with

  • Present Mild touch—handholding, reassuring pats


Validate and Redirect



  • Validate feelings: “I listen to your problem, let’s look alongside one another.”

  • Redirect Carefully: shift focus to your constructive subject or memory

  • Use reminiscence therapy to evoke joy and tranquil

Adapting as Dementia Progresses


The extent of help evolves over time. Remaining educated assists you pivot proficiently.


Early Stage Techniques



  • Stimulate conclusion-creating and independence

  • Memory resources: reminders, labeled storage, calendars

  • Engage in mentally stimulating routines


Middle Phase Changes



  • Introduce extra guidance for the duration of self-care and cooking

  • Use Visible cues and structured environments
